What is kernel clock?

The other is the “system clock” (sometimes called the “kernel clock” or “software clock”) which is a software counter based on the timer interrupt. It does not exist when the system is not running, so it has to be initialized from the RTC (or some other time source) at boot time.

What is the use of clock source?

The purpose of the clock source is to provide a timeline for the system that tells you where you are in time. For example issuing the command ‘date’ on a Linux system will eventually read the clock source to determine exactly what time it is.

What is system clock in Linux?

Real-Time Clock in Linux

Two clocks are important in Linux: a ‘hardware clock’, also known as RTC, CMOS or BIOS clock. This is the battery-backed clock that keeps time even when the system is shut down. The second clock is called the ‘system clock/tick’ or ‘kernel clock’ and is maintained by the operating system.

What is kernel tick rate?

The kernel “tick” frequency is all about how often the kernel should check what process is running, what process wants to be running and what to do about it. Clearly that must be a lot slower than the actual execution rate of instructions on the machine.

THIS IS INTERESTING:  Frequent question: Can you take a shower with Apple Watch Series 3?

How does hardware clock work?

A personal computer has a battery driven hardware clock. The battery ensures that the clock will work even if the rest of the computer is without electricity. The hardware clock can be set from the BIOS setup screen or from whatever operating system is running.

What is KVM clock?

kvm-clock is a Linux clocksource like tsc and hpet. ( tsc is commonly used on physical machines.) The discussion at the URL below indicates that all clocksources act like time counters that are periodically read by interrupts.

What is Jiffies in Linux kernel?

The global variable “jiffies” holds the number of ticks that have occurred since the system booted. On boot, the kernel initializes the variable to zero, and it is incremented by one during each timer interrupt. Thus, because there are HZ timer interrupts in a second, there are HZ jiffies in a second.

What is the difference between hardware clock and system clock?

System clock (sometimes called the “kernel clock” or “software clock”) which is a software counter based on the timer interrupt. hwclock –systohc is the command used to sync both the clocks.

What is clock resolution?

The smallest possible increase of time the clock model allows is called resolution. If your clock increments its value only once per second, your resolution is also one second. … Therefore the smallest possible increase of time that can be experienced by a program is called precision.

How do I display a clock in Linux?

To display date and time under Linux operating system using command prompt use the date command. It can also display the current time / date in the given FORMAT. We can set the system date and time as root user too.

THIS IS INTERESTING:  Best answer: Why are my activity rings not working on Apple Watch?

Is Hz a tick rate?

Tick rate is the frequency at which a server updates game data, which is measured in hertz (Hz). For example, Battlefield 4 has servers with frequency rates of 20, 40, 60, or more hertz. If such servers were in Counter-Strike: Global Offensive, then we would say that they have a 20, 40, and 60 tick rate, respectively.

How many ticks is a 1 Hz?

Clock speed is measured by how many ticks per second the clock makes. The unit of measurement called a hertz (Hz), which is technically one cycle per second, is used to measure clock speed. In the case of computer clock speed, one hertz equals one tick per second.

What is timer frequency Linux kernel?

Linux timer interrupt frequency is an important parameter for near to real-time and multimedia applications running on Linux. The timer interrupt frequency directly impacts the capability of any near-to real time and multimedia application to process events at high frequencies.